🔑 Enhanced Key Takeaways

  • Meitu's strategic pivot toward B2B enterprise solutions, specifically 'Meitu Design Studio' and 'WinkStudio', has become a primary driver for revenue growth, moving the company beyond its consumer-facing photo editing roots.
  • The company's proprietary 'MiracleVision' (奇想智能) large model has undergone significant iteration, now supporting multi-modal generation capabilities that directly integrate into the workflow of professional designers and e-commerce merchants.
  • Meitu has aggressively expanded its international footprint, with AI-driven subscription growth in Southeast Asia and North America contributing significantly to the record-breaking 16.91 million paid user base.

Timeline

2008-10
Meitu launches its flagship photo editing software, Meitu XiuXiu.
2016-12
Meitu completes its IPO on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ange.
2023-06
Meitu officially releases the MiracleVision (奇想智能) large model.
2024-03
Meitu reports its first full year of profitability since listing, driven by AI subscriptions.
